Application Software Engineer – Dana Incorporated, Rivoli (TO)

Join Dana, a global leader in high‑performance powertrain and thermal management technologies, as an Application Software Engineer. The role focuses on developing application‑level software for electrified passenger‑car powertrains, primarily at the Dana Rivoli plant in Italy.

Position Summary

The successful candidate will support the development of application software for high‑performance passenger‑car applications. After initial training in Dana’s Rivoli (IT) and Lindley (UK) plants, the engineer will contribute to SW and calibration development for both vehicle and test rig, with the aim of delivering electrified powertrain systems equipped with Dana powershifting transmissions.

The position is based at the Rivoli Plant (IT) and reports directly to the Lead Engineer – Application Software. Additional on‑field activities may include cold/winter, hot/summer, and altitude testing.

Main Responsibilities
  • Deliver application software for electrified powertrains, focusing on transmission drivability, vehicle integration, and interfaces.
  • Act as the primary interface between OEMs and Dana teams for powertrain development, calibration, and vehicle validation.
  • Translate requirements from design to production and support development to commission, debug and optimize electrified powershifting transmission systems.
  • Coordinate validation, verification and test programs for embedded systems, ensuring compliance with safety requirements.
  • Develop hands‑on experience with vehicle system architectures and control system applications.
  • Participate in on‑field testing such as cold/winter, hot/summer, and altitude campaigns.
Job Position Requirements

Education: Master’s degree in Mechatronic, Mechanical or Automotive Engineering, or a related field.

Professional Background:

  • Minimum of 5 years (Senior) in software development and/or powertrain calibration.
  • Experience with vehicle testing and the ability to diagnose and resolve drivability issues or customer complaints.
Hard Skills
  • Algorithm design and implementation in a model‑based environment (Matlab/Simulink or ASCET‑SD).
  • Vehicle and/or test‑rig based development experience.
  • Knowledge of vehicle communication networks (CAN, CAN‑FD, J1939, XCP).
  • Understanding of functional safety and automated transmission fundamentals.
  • Transmission software delivery, testing, and engineering sign‑off.
  • Calibration tools experience, ideally CANape.
  • Understanding of electrical and mechanical system interactions.
  • Structured, logical problem‑solving approach.
  • Proficient in English and Italian.
Considered a Plus
  • Previous experience with dual‑clutch transmissions.
  • Deep understanding of mechatronic system interfaces.
  • Experience with calibration tools (CANape), protocol tools (CANalyzer) and diagnostic protocols (UDS).
